Mod Podge is a versatile product that can be used on a variety of surfaces, including fabric and plastic. When used on fabric, Mod Podge can act as both a glue and a sealer. It can help prevent fraying and can be used to attach fabric to a variety of surfaces such as wood, plastic, or paper. For example, you can use Mod Podge to attach fabric to a wooden frame or box, or to decoupage fabric onto plastic drawers or light switches.

To use Mod Podge on fabric, it is recommended to first wash and dry the fabric, then coat it with Fabric Mod Podge. This will help to prevent fraying and create clean, straight edges. You can then cut the fabric to the desired size and shape. It is also suggested to cover both the fabric and the surface you are attaching it to with Mod Podge before putting them together, as this will create a stronger bond.

When using Mod Podge on plastic, it is important to note that some types of plastic may repel the Mod Podge. It is recommended to use a formula specifically designed for use on plastic, such as a water-resistant or gloss formula. You can apply the Mod Podge to the fabric or directly to the plastic surface, depending on your project.

Additionally, Mod Podge can be used as a protective coating over fabric. For example, you can apply a coat of Hard Coat Mod Podge over fabric to seal and protect it from damage. This is especially useful for surfaces that will be handled frequently or in high-traffic areas, such as bookshelves or furniture.

Mod Podge dries clear and is permanent

Mod Podge is a versatile product that can be used on a variety of surfaces, including fabric and plastic. It acts as both a glue and a sealer and is available in different finishes, such as matte and gloss. Mod Podge can be used to decorate and transform various items, from furniture to storage units, giving them a personalised touch.

When it comes to using Mod Podge, it's important to remember that it dries clear and is permanent. This means that you can confidently apply it to your projects without worrying about any unsightly residue or discolouration. The clear finish of Mod Podge allows the underlying colours, patterns, or designs to shine through, making it ideal for showcasing your creativity.

However, it's worth noting that the drying time of Mod Podge can vary. Typically, it dries to the touch within 15 to 20 minutes, but the environment, temperature, and humidity can influence this process. In colder climates or high-humidity conditions, Mod Podge may take longer to dry and could even dry opaquely. Therefore, it is recommended to use Mod Podge at room temperature and allow for adequate drying time between coats.

To ensure the best results, it is advised to apply several thin layers of Mod Podge, allowing each layer to dry completely before adding the next. This technique helps prevent clumping and ensures a smooth, clear finish. While Mod Podge dries clear most of the time, there are instances where user errors or external factors can affect its transparency.

Additionally, the type of Mod Podge you choose can impact the final appearance. For example, the matte finish dries clear with a non-shiny appearance, while the gloss finish adds a layer of sheen to your project. Reading the label and choosing the appropriate Mod Podge product for your specific project is essential to achieving the desired outcome.

Mod Podge can be used to decorate furniture

Mod Podge is a versatile product that can be used to decorate furniture in a variety of ways. It can act as both a glue and a sealer, making it perfect for upcycling furniture. Mod Podge is suitable for use on a range of surfaces, including wood, plastic, fabric, paper, glass, and metal.

When using Mod Podge to decorate furniture, it is important to start with a thin, flexible material such as fabric or paper, and a bulky base to attach it to. The base could be a piece of furniture such as a table, chair, stool, cabinet, bookcase, or dresser. For the best results, it is recommended to use thicker paper to avoid wrinkles.

Before applying Mod Podge, ensure that the paper or fabric is cut to size and placed face down. Apply a thin layer of Mod Podge to the base item using a foam brush, then cover the back of the paper or fabric with a layer of Mod Podge. Place the item on the base, smooth it down, and let it dry for 15-20 minutes. For a more textured look, you can apply Mod Podge to both the base and the paper/fabric before attaching them together.

For added protection, especially on surfaces that will be handled frequently, a coat of Hard Coat Mod Podge can be applied over the fabric or paper. This will seal and protect the surface from damage. The Mod Podge should be allowed to dry thoroughly between coats, and it can be sanded to a smooth finish if desired.
